1. Overview of coffee bean producing areas

Coffee is one of the most popular drinks in the world, and the origin of coffee beans is an important factor in determining the flavor and quality of coffee. There are many different geographical environments and climatic conditions around the world, which makes the coffee beans produced in each producing area have a unique and rich taste and aroma.

2. Latin America

Latin America is one of the most famous and important coffee bean producing areas in the world. This region includes countries such as Colombia, Brazil, and Mexico. Latin America is famous for its mild and warm climate conditions, which are very suitable for the growth of coffee trees and provide them with sufficient sunlight and water.

3. Africa

Africa is also an important coffee bean producing region, with Ethiopia being considered the original Heirloom center. Ethiopia is famous for its high altitude mountains, fertile soil and suitable climatic conditions, which together give Ethiopian coffee beans a unique floral aroma and rich taste.

4. Asia

Asia is also an important coffee bean producing region, with the most famous countries including India, Indonesia and Vietnam. These regions are generally known for their strong and full-bodied taste and dark roasting style. For example, coffee beans produced in Indonesia are usually strong and somewhat bitter.
